怎么在VPS上用软件
虚拟专用服务器(VPS)是一种虚拟服务器,它在具有独立操作系统和资源的物理主机上运行。使用VPS可以实现自由管理自己的网站和应用程序,而且比共享主机更稳定和安全。然而,要使自己的网站或应用程序在VPS上运行,必须安装和配置所需的软件。这篇文章将介绍如何在VPS上使用软件。
了解VPS上的软件类型
为了在VPS上使用软件,您需要了解有哪些类型的软件可用。VPS上的软件分为几种类型,包括:
Web服务器:Web服务器是在VPS上托管网站时必需的。一些流行的Web服务器包括Apache、Nginx和IIS。
数据库服务器:如果您的网站需要存储和管理数据,您就需要一个数据库服务器。一些流行的数据库服务器包括MySQL、PostgreSQL和MongoDB。
编程语言环境:要托管和运行特定编程语言的应用程序,您需要在VPS上安装相应的编程语言环境。例如,如果您想在VPS上托管PHP应用程序,则需要安装PHP语言环境。
其他应用程序:除了Web服务器、数据库服务器和编程语言环境外,还有其他一些应用程序可能需要在VPS上安装,例如邮件服务器、文件服务器和聊天服务器。
在安装和配置VPS上的软件之前,您需要确定要使用哪种类型的软件。
使用包管理器安装软件
在VPS上安装和配置软件的最简单方法是使用包管理器。包管理器是一种软件管理工具,可以帮助您安装、更新和卸载软件。Linux操作系统上的大多数发行版都有自己的包管理器。例如,Ubuntu发行版上的包管理器是apt-get,CentOS发行版上的包管理器是yum。
使用包管理器安装软件的步骤如下:
登录VPS。
打开终端窗口。
使用包管理器搜索要安装的软件。例如,要安装Apache Web服务器,可以输入以下命令:sudo apt-get update
sudo apt-get install apache2
等待软件安装完成。
使用包管理器安装软件可以大大简化安装和配置过程,因为它自动处理软件的依赖性和版本兼容性。然而,包管理器可能无法提供最新版本的软件,而且在某些情况下可能会出现依赖性问题。
手动安装软件
如果包管理器无法提供所需的软件版本,或者您需要进行自定义配置,您可以手动安装软件。手动安装软件需要进行以下步骤:
下载软件包。您可以从软件开发者的网站或软件存储库下载软件包。例如,要下载Apache Web服务器,可以访问官方网站。
解压软件包。使用解压工具将下载的软件包解压到指定的目录中。
配置软件。使用指南和教程来配置软件,以满足您的特定需求。
编译和安装软件。使用软件的安装说明来编译和安装软件。
手动安装软件可以提供更大的灵活性和控制,因为您可以根据特定需求定制软件配置。然而,手动安装软件可能需要更多的时间和经验,并且可能出现依赖性问题。
在VPS上使用软件需要选择合适的软件类型,并使用适当的安装方法进行安装和配置。使用包管理器可以大大简化软件安装和配置过程,如果无法提供所需的软件版本或自定义配置,则可以使用手动安装方法。无论使用哪种方法,都应该遵循安全和最佳实践,并经常更新软件以确保安全和稳定性。